Abstract: This study intends to be an analysis on the vision of Alexander the Great in the field of alterity, and his change of perspective in relation to his new subjects. In the fourth century BC, our character consciously tried to assimilate under his reign, peacefully, all the identity sensitivities that were part of his new empire. The historical sources appear, but not exclusively, as the tools to be used to understand their decision, which neutralized the Hellenic identity construction that considered the Achaemenian Persians as Barbarians by antonomasia.
